Frank Schneck Obituary

Frank E. Schneck Frank E. Schneck, 70, of Deturksville Rd., Pine Grove, passed away on Sunday, May 23, 2021 in the Hershey Medical Center. Born on April 11, 1951 in Pine Grove, he was a son of the late Ernest And Emily Hoy Schneck. He was a 1970 graduate of Pine Grove Area High School and was a member of St. Peter’s Lutheran Church, Pine Grove. Frank was a truck driver for 47 years for The Haven Line Industries, Schuylkill Haven He loved his family, especially his grandchildren, feeding the fish in his pond and his tractors. Surviving are his wife of 50 years, Faye Reinhart Schneck; a daughter, Tammy Zimmerman; two grandchildren, Lindsey and husband Donald Legarht, and Logan Zimmerman, all of Pine Grove; two brothers, David and wife Emma Jane Schneck of Zionsville, Lynn and wife Linda Schneck of Pine Grove; three sisters, Dawn Koehler, Marion and husband Nick DeFlavio, Dana and husband Myrl Troutman, all of Pine Grove, nieces and nephews. Graveside Services and interment will be held on Thursday, May 27, 2021 at 11:00 A.M., at St. John’s Lutheran Cemetery, W. Wood St., Pine Grove with Pastor Barry Spatz officiating.
